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ive and assess the situation to find out the best course of action.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and contamination. This may involve sealing off doors, windows, and other entry points to prevent sewage from spreading.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Cleanup
Next, we’ll extract any standing water from the affected area using powerful pumps and wet vacuums. We’ll also remove any debris, sewage, and other contaminants that may be present.
Step 3: Disinfection and Sanitizing
Once the area is clean, we’ll disinfect and sanitize it using specialized equipment and techniques to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ms.
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ification
Finally,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area and remove any excess moisture. This helps prevent further damage and promotes a healthy environment.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Colon, NE
The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Colon, NE.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can give you a general idea of what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and cleanup |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the amount of water present, and the type of equipment needed. |
| Disinfection and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the level of contamination.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the level of moisture present. |
| Assessment and containment | $50 – $200 | The complexity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ment needed. |
| Emergency response and mobilization | $100 – $500 | The time of day, the location of the affected area, and the level of urgency. |
| Post-cleanup inspection and verification | $50 – $200 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the level of contamination. |

Common Questions About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ection
Q: How long does sewage cleanup and disinfection take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ete sewage cleanup and disinfection depends on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the level of contamination. On average,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ete the process.
Q: Is sewage cleanup and disinfection covered by insurance?
A: Yes, sewage cleanup and disinfection can be covered by insurance. But, it’s essential to check with your insurance provider to find out what is covered and what is not.
Q: Can I do sewage cleanup and disinfection myself?
A: While it’s possible to do some minor sewage cleanup and disinfection yourself, it’s not recommended. Sewage cleanup and disinfection need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ure that the job is done correctly and safely.
Q: How do I prevent sewage backups and overflows?
A: There are several steps you can take to prevent sewage backups and overflows, including regular maintenance of your plumbing system, checking for clogs and blockages, and keeping grease and other substances out of your drains.
